About The Customer
Valeo is a publicly traded French automotive supplier with 113,600 employees worldwide and annual sales of €19.3 billion as of December 2018. Known globally as an automotive supplier, Valeo is — at its core — an innovative technology company and a leader in driverless cars and CO2 emission reductions. The company operates in 33 countries and has automated 300+ processes for nearly 70,000 users across all of their global offices. These business processes utilize data from many document storage systems, SAP ERP, and various internal point solutions. Valeo’s business processes include HR, Finance & Accounting, Operations and Development.
The Challenge
Valeo, a global automotive industry supplier, was facing significant delays in its business process management (BPM) approval process, which took 90 seconds or longer. This resulted in a surplus of user complaints and a major decrease in customer satisfaction. The company needed to improve its business processes to meet new demands and accommodate its aggressive growth rate goals. Valeo's previous BPM, a Fujitsu product, was not able to keep up with the company's fast-growing needs for workflow applications, including mobile interface.
The Solution
Valeo adopted ProcessMaker as its new BPM platform. ProcessMaker offered the tech stack that the company needed to handle to accelerate its OEM offering. The switch allowed Valeo to introduce extreme agility in the way it fulfilled the company’s fast-growing needs for workflow applications, including mobile interface. The Valeo team developed unique implementations with Google, including Actions by Email (similar to the ProcessMaker I/O offering). Valeo was one of Google’s first large G Suite implementations in Europe. ProcessMaker integrated with G Suite to streamline Valeo’s business processes.

Integral Plant Maintenance
Mercedes-Benz and his partner GAZ chose Siemens to be its maintenance partner at a new engine plant in Yaroslavl, Russia. The new plant offers a capacity to manufacture diesel engines for the Russian market, for locally produced Sprinter Classic. In addition to engines for the local market, the Yaroslavl plant will also produce spare parts. Mercedes-Benz Russia and his partner needed a service partner in order to ensure the operation of these lines in a maintenance partnership arrangement. The challenges included coordinating the entire maintenance management operation, in particular inspections, corrective and predictive maintenance activities, and the optimizing spare parts management. Siemens developed a customized maintenance solution that includes all electronic and mechanical maintenance activities (Integral Plant Maintenance).
